0

我是 2007 年的新手

我有 3 个表和一个表格..我有AccountsITSoftware表..我创建了每个表并为它们输入了一个值(ID、描述)..我有另一个名为Faculty的表,我有AccountsIDAccountsDesc , ITDescSoftwareDesc作为我的 组合框中的属性表单。所以当我做我的查询时,一切工作正常。即使 Accounts Desc 以第一个字符开头为“F”,它也能够拿起它..因为财务已经输入到我的数据库中..我的问题我想添加一个新的组合框中的帐户名称没有从数据库中添加?..如果再次选择它可以保存在我的下拉列表中..我尝试了很多方法,但我不能..任何人都可以解决我的问题?..

4

1 回答 1

1

您只能让您的组合列表自动来自表格,或者手动将其输入到值列表中。你不能两者都做。

因此,要解决您的问题,您必须使用 VBA。我只是在这里给你粗略的步骤。如果您不知道如何执行步骤,您可以搜索详细信息。

Form_Load事件中,您将构建您的列表。为此,您可以打开列表中包含所需值的表或查询,一次读取一条记录,然后将值输入组合框中。
将项目添加到组合框的命令是ComboboxName.AddItem value
然后添加您想要的附加值。ComboboxName.AddItem "新账户"

祝你好运

于 2013-03-09T15:54:26.100 回答